In the domain of automotive maintenance and repair, the auto fuse stands as a primary diagnostic checkpoint. Its simplicity belies its importance. When an electrical accessory or system in a vehicle ceases to function, the initial troubleshooting step is almost universally to inspect the relevant fuse. This process involves locating the vehicle's fuse panels, consulting the diagram (usually on the panel lid or in the owner's manual) to identify the correct fuse for the malfunctioning system, and then physically inspecting that fuse. For blade fuses, this can often be done visually by looking for a broken metal strip inside the transparent plastic housing. A digital multimeter can be used to check for continuity, providing a more definitive diagnosis. The act of replacing a fuse is simple, but interpreting why it blew is the key to a lasting repair. A single, isolated fuse failure might be due to a random power surge or a transient fault. However, a fuse that blows repeatedly immediately after replacement is a clear indicator of a persistent fault within the circuit. This could be a short to ground in the wiring harness, a failed component (like a motor or solenoid that has shorted windings), or a problem with a control module. For instance, if the fuse for the brake lights keeps blowing, the technician would investigate the brake light switch, the wiring running to the rear of the vehicle, and the brake light sockets themselves for signs of a short circuit. The fuse, in this case, guides the mechanic directly to the problematic circuit. Furthermore, fuses are integral to vehicle customization and restoration. When restoring a classic car, the entire wiring harness is often replaced, and a modern fuse box is installed to provide reliable protection that the original vehicle may have lacked. When installing aftermarket equipment like a high-wattage sound system, off-road lighting, or a winch, the installation must include an appropriately rated fuse placed as close to the battery's positive terminal as possible. This fuse protects the new power cable from a short circuit along its entire length, which could otherwise lead to a battery fire. The correct selection of fuse amperage for such additions is calculated based on the maximum current draw of the device and the current-carrying capacity of the wire.
